WebSome key differences in symptoms may include: Fever: Although not everyone with pneumonia develops a fever, it is common. Chest or back pain: Pneumonia often causes pain in the chest or back. While COPD may cause chest tightening, it is a different quality of pain than pneumonia.

WebMay 6, 2013 · People with COPD may experience a fever, but not that often. Generally fevers are associated with infectious diseases, says Cirillo. Smoking is the most common cause of COPD, not a bacteria... WebCOPD has some of the same symptoms as colds, flu, and pneumonia.
